General Course Information
This course replaces Digital Audio Signal Processing and Active Noice Control.
Course code | VTA132 (7.5 credits) |
Lecturer | Wolfgang Kropp, Jens Ahrens |
Assistant | Thomas Deppisch (DSP exercise) |
Lecture hall | Lecture room at TA |
Grading | Home assignments and lab report |
Course PM |
Noteboard
2022-08-09 by Jens Ahrens
Welcome to the course! We’ll start on Tues., Aug. 30 at 10.00 h in the TA lecture room.
Course Materials
Lecture
- DSP1: Quantization, AD/DA conversion (pdf, pdf)
- DSP2: LTI systems, nonlinear systems (pdf, pdf)
- DSP3: Digital Filters (pdf)
- DSP4: Measurement of LTI systems (pdf)
- DSP5: Perceptual audio coding (pdf)
- DSP6: Fractional delays (pdf)
- DSP7: Dynamic range control (pdf)
- DSP8: Numerical methods (pdf)
- ANC1: Lecture 1
- ANC2: Lecture 2
- ANC2: Lecture 3
- ANC2: Lecture 4
- ANC2: Lecture 5
- ANC2: Lecture 6
- ANC2: Lecture 7
- ANC2: Lecture 8
- ANC2: Lecture 9
- ANC2: Lecture 10
- ANC2: Lecture 11
- ANC2: Lecture 12
Exercise Lessons
- Introduction Slides
- E1: Matlab Live Script with general concepts
- E2: Matlab Live Script about the DFT and quantization
- E3: Matlab Live Script about FIR and IIR filtering
- E4: Matlab Live Script for measurement analysis
- E5: Matlab Live Script for dynamic processing
- E6: Matlab Live Script for the LMS filter
Assignments
- A1: Sampling, Quantization, Dithering
- A2: Filters, speech.wav
- A3: Measurements, system.zip
- A4: Dynamic Processing
- A5: LMS Filter, additional files
ANC Lab
Implementation of an ANC system in a ventilation duct. The work is strongly linked to the lectures. The laboratory work is mandatory and the final report of the work is a part of the examination. The work starts with an introduction (see course pm). This lecture is compulsory. There are no fixed times for the laboratory work given in the main schedule of the Masters Programme. More information is given during the course.
Matlab Examples ANC
- ANC LMS-Demo: LMS_DEMO
- ANC Files: Lab Files
- ANC Files: Lab PM part 1
- ANC Files: Lab PM part 2
- ANC Files: Lab PM part 3
- ANC Files: Lab PM part 4
- ANC Files: Lab PM part 5
Literature
DSP
- Introduction to Audio Processing (accessible with Chalmers IP)
- DSP Guide by S. W. Smith
- Mathematics of the Discrete Fourier Transform (DFT) With Audio Applications by J. O. Smith III
- All the other online books by J. O. Smith III
- Filters (with coefficient tables)
- All About Audio Equalization: Solutions and Frontiers
- H1 estimator
- Sweep measurements
- IEEE Magazine article on fractional delays by Laakso et al. (accessible with a Chalmers IP) (Matlab toolbox)
- Dynamic range control
ANC
- Nelson, P. A., Elliot, S. J., “Active Control of Sound”, Academic Press (1992). This is available at Chalmers Library as e-book. In addition, the lecture notes above are used.
- Reading Advice ANC